Translate

No posts with label William Lyon MacKenzie and Louis-Joseph Papineau : The Struggle for Responsible Government [The Makers of Canada. Show all posts
No posts with label William Lyon MacKenzie and Louis-Joseph Papineau : The Struggle for Responsible Government [The Makers of Canada. Show all posts